Becoming a Certified Professional in Regenerative Innovations signifies a commitment to a rapidly growing field. The certification program equips professionals with the knowledge and skills necessary to design, implement, and evaluate regenerative solutions across various sectors.
Learning outcomes for the Certified Professional in Regenerative Innovations program typically include a deep understanding of regenerative principles, circular economy models, and sustainable agriculture practices. Participants gain proficiency in assessing environmental impact, developing regenerative strategies, and measuring the effectiveness of implemented solutions. This involves practical application of life cycle assessment (LCA) and material flow analysis (MFA) techniques.
The duration of the Certified Professional in Regenerative Innovations program varies depending on the provider and the specific curriculum. However, many programs are designed to be completed within several months of dedicated study, potentially through a blended learning approach incorporating online modules and in-person workshops. Some programs might offer a more flexible, self-paced learning experience.
